Proposal
Description of Proposed Heritage Repair Works The proposed works comprise heritage repair and reinstatement works to the existing listed building following structural movement and associated cracking. The works are intended to conserve the building's existing historic character and fabric, with repair undertaken in preference to replacement wherever practicable. Externally, the works will include carefully raking out and repairing fractured mortar joints and repointing using a compatible mortar with colour, texture, joint profile and finish selected to match the existing historic masonry. Localised damaged facing bricks will only be replaced where they cannot reasonably be retained, with replacement bricks selected to closely match the existing in size, colour, texture and appearance. Localised structural crack repairs will include the installation of stainless-steel stitching anchors where required, with the surrounding masonry carefully made good. Specialist heritage stonework repairs will also be undertaken to the existing bay windows, retaining the original stonework wherever possible and using sympathetic repair techniques and compatible materials. Internally, localised cracking will be repaired with the minimum necessary disturbance to the existing fabric. Affected plaster finishes will be carefully repaired and reinstated, together with the restoration/reinstatement of decorative cornices, wallpaper, lining paper and existing timber features affected by the works. Existing timber elements, including the bay window, doors, frames, skirtings and architraves, will be retained and repaired wherever practicable rather than replaced, with finishes reinstated to match the existing character of the property. Temporary scaffold access will be provided where necessary to allow the heritage repairs to be undertaken safely and accurately. The process from here
This application is with South Kesteven for determination. The council publicises it, consults neighbours and technical bodies where required, and weighs the responses against local and national planning policy.
The statutory target is eight weeks for most applications and thirteen for major development, though extensions of time are common. Comments carry most weight while the case is undecided, so check the council portal for the deadline if you want to respond.
About heritage and listed buildings applications
How this application type works
Heritage applications concern listed buildings and conservation areas. Listed building consent is needed for works, inside or out, that affect the special interest of a listed building, and carrying out such works without consent is a criminal offence. The council weighs harm to the heritage asset against any public benefit of the proposal.
